Output 8ef40c548613d5d2e0ee75402297ee30aa962369858bb56eace0eaf1bb825ade:1

value
520629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d9215bfaacf674e98ac39a2501c6d5d155ea4d6 OP_EQUAL
address
38mAxUXQjjnXmpUnCqUMxixWrdZ8LWiuBs
transaction
8ef40c548613d5d2e0ee75402297ee30aa962369858bb56eace0eaf1bb825ade
spent
true